Six of our ten spacious guest rooms have fireplaces and two others offer ocean views. All have private baths and comfortable sitting areas. Each room is beautifully decorated with Early American antique and pine furnishings. There are five guest rooms in the Main House, as well as our charming parlor -- a place to gather with fellow guests and enjoy the afternoon tea and sweets provided.

The rest of the Joshua Grindle Inn's rooms are in two lovingly restored outbuildings behind the Main House.
